
Creating the environment for success can
be replicated anywhere. One of the key ingredients for
success in the Internet Economy is workforce freedom.
Labor mobility is vital to a booming economy. At Cisco, we
create a work environment where people want to work. We have one of the lowest
voluntary turnover rates in industry and we recognize the importance of workers
who want to pursue other opportunities should be allowed to do so. A motivated
worker is a productive worker and that is good for the entire economy.
The ability of workers to freely leave for other opportunities
is:
I. Good
for the employee – leaving a job to find a situation
that an employee finds interesting or challenging produces
a good worker. Additionally, to keep employees happy, companies
often add benefits and perks.
II.
Good for the company – companies want motivated, happy
workers. These workers are more productive and add more
value than unhappy workers.
III.
Good for the shareholder – productive workers are
good for productivity, which, in turn, often leads to stock
appreciation.
IV.
Good for the economy – happy, productive workers
produce more goods, more efficiently.
